LONGSPAN Camera Unit: long-range POE (powered from Base unit). Working together, LONGSPAN’s Base and Camera units deliver unprecedented power and bandwidth over extreme lengths of regular Cat 5e or Cat 6 network cable, enabling a dependable connection to IP cameras and other remote network devices. IP cameras can demand peak network bandwidth of several times their average data rate while transmitting critical high-activity or low-light scenes. That's why LONGSPAN has been designed to support the full 200Mbps bandwidth required for reliable 100Base-T Ethernet at up to 840 metres Cat 6 (or 690 metres Cat 5e).
- As a point-to-point solution with no mid-cable equipment and smart, automatic self-configuration, installation is simple and instantaneous.
- LONGSPAN even supports single-pair UTP cables, providing a fast upgrade solution for legacy analogue systems.
- For longer distances, LONGSPAN can automatically negotiate a 10Base-T connection, supporting a range in excess of 1000 metres and over ten times the conventional limit for cabled Ethernet.
